Shirah Mansaray is the CEO and founding trustee of the international charity, I Am Somebody’s Child Soldier, which provides mental health support to former child victims of war in Uganda. Shirah has over 15 years’ experience working in the humanitarian field, with organisations ranging from the United Nations and the Human Rights and Economic Affairs Department at the Council of Europe, Strasbourg. Shirah is a Non-Executive Director and Trustee of Amnesty International UK.Shirah is passionate about advocating for mental health as a fundamental human right for populations in the Global South and worldwide.Shirah is currently a PhD scholar at University College London (UCL) conducting academic and industry research on healthcare policies and architectures that promote mental health through design responsibility and sustainable environmental design. She has a Master’s degree in Development, Technology and Innovation Policy from UCL, where her thesis interrogated the efficacy of the World Food Program’s Blockchain based digital identification system and the data privacy rights of refugees.Shirah is a trained lawyer and is currently seconded to Bates Wells LLP where she advises charities, non-profits and civil society organisations in the UK and internationally on governance matters, commercial agreements, charity law and human rights law.From child soldier to mental health advocate, Shirah shares her journey of compassion and change. Raised between the UK and Uganda, she founded I Am Somebody’s Child Soldier to support former child soldiers. Now a vice chair at Amnesty International and a PhD researcher, she champions mental health as a human rights issue.In this conversation, Shirah discusses trauma, advocacy, and global injustices while balancing leadership and academia. Learn more at theleaderslab.coSondre Rasch is co-founder and CEO of SafetyWing, an all-remote company that is building a global social safety net. Sondre studied economics and computer science then worked as a social policy advisor for the government of Norway. Dissatisfied with the slow pace of change, he founded the SuperSide platform (YC 2016) for freelance designers and discovered the lack of social safety net for people working on the internet.This inspired the creation of SafetyWing (YC 2018), which has so far raised $50 million in venture capital and whose globally-distributed team consists of 150 people from 60+ countries. What if you grew up being told by others (including your school teachers) that you would never amount to anything because of a neurodevelopmental condition?Jamie Waller, a dyslexic entrepreneur, philanthropist, and investor has proven that these supposed “disabilities” can be a great edge in achieving amazing things in life. Despite leaving school without qualifications, Jamie defied expectations by starting multiple businesses, becoming a multimillionaire in his twenties, and even starring in a TV show documenting his entrepreneurial journey. Inspired by a conversation with Sir Richard Branson in 2022, Waller wrote The Dyslexic Edge, a book that challenges the idea of dyslexia as a deficit. Instead, he showcases research and interviews with successful dyslexics, proving that dyslexia can be a unique advantage.In this interview, we explore eye-opening statistics (15% of the population is dyslexic, yet 35% of entrepreneurs and over 45% of self-made millionaires share this trait. However, over 50% of the prison population is also dyslexic, revealing the systemic challenges these individuals face). According to Waller, the education system discriminates against diverse learning styles, labeling dyslexia as a disorder rather than recognizing it as a strength in global exploratory learning — the ability to discover, invent, and create.Discover how Jamie’s journey and groundbreaking insights can inspire you to see challenges as opportunities and harness your unique strengths to achieve greatness—tune in to this podcast and unlock the potential of The Dyslexic Edge!ABOUT OUR GUESTJamie Waller is dyslexic and a serial entrepreneur, philanthropist, and investor. Despite leaving school with no qualifications he started multiple businesses, became a multimillionaire in his twenties and featured in a prime-time TV show that followed him starting his first business. Currently, Jamie owns a venture capital fund, has thirteen companies under management and employs over 1,000 people worldwide.
